What Is Google Analytics?

Google Analytics (GA) is a powerful free tool from Google that helps you analyze your website’s performance. It shows:

  • How many people visit your site

  • Where your visitors come from

  • Which pages they view

  • How long they stay

  • What actions they take (clicks, purchases, sign-ups)

  • Which devices they use

  • And much more!

In 2023, Google introduced GA4 (Google Analytics 4) — the latest version that focuses on event-based tracking and cross-platform analytics (web + apps).

How Google Analytics Works (Simple Explanation)

Google Analytics uses a tracking code inserted into your website.
Here’s how it works:

  1. User visits your site
    When someone opens your website, GA starts tracking their actions.

  2. Tracking code collects data
    GA monitors pages visited, session time, device type, browser, and actions taken.

  3. Data is sent to Google Analytics servers
    All user activity is processed and categorized.

  4. You see reports in your dashboard
    Traffic sources, user behavior, conversions, and more.

✔ GA4 = Event-Based Tracking

Unlike Universal Analytics, GA4 tracks everything as an event (page_view, click, scroll).


Key Features of Google Analytics (GA4)

1. Real-Time Analytics

View active users on your site right now.

2. Traffic Source Tracking

Shows where your visitors come from:

  • Organic (SEO)

  • Social media

  • Direct

  • Email

  • Paid ads

  • Referral websites

3. Engagement Reports

Tracks how users interact with your site:

  • Page views

  • Scroll depth

  • Events

  • Time on page

4. Conversions Tracking

Track goals like:

  • Lead form submission

  • Button clicks

  • Purchases

  • Newsletter sign-ups

5. Audience Insights

Understand your users’:

  • Location

  • Device

  • Interests

  • Browser

  • Operating system

6. E-Commerce Tracking

Monitor:

  • Revenue

  • Orders

  • Cart abandonment

  • Product performance

7. Custom Reports

Create personalized dashboards as per business needs.

How to Get Started With Google Analytics (Quick Steps)

  1. Visit analytics.google.com

  2. Sign in with your Google account

  3. Create a property (Website/App)

  4. Set up GA4

  5. Install tracking code on your site

  6. Verify tracking

  7. Start analyzing data
